2016 music streaming service Rhapsody
announced it will be globally rebranding
as Napster in the summer Rhapsody was
already using the Napster name in
countries outside of the United States
you guys remember Napster right it was
this amazing music discovery tool
created by John Fanning Shawn Fanning
and Shawn Parker back in 1999 it allowed
you to share your music library with
others and anyone could download anyone
elses library this was and still is
highly illegal Napster was basically
sued out of existence after Napster's
bankruptcy its brand was sold off to
rock Co then Best Buy and then finally
Rhapsody in December 2011 where after

now Rhapsody announced it had nearly 3.5
million subscribers back in December
2015
Apple recently announced its Apple music
service past the 15 million subscriber
mark Spotify pulls in about 30 million
paid subscribers with those numbers it
definitely looks like an uphill battle
for the new Napster best of luck to you
